Hot Pot Smile Aug 15, 2012   
Share on TwitterShare on Facebook
Categories : Japanese | Restaurant | Steamboat/Hot Pot | BBQ

This hot pot restaurant has many different choices to choose from. You can choose the type of soup base that you want which is either sukiyaki or shabu-shabu. I prefer the sukiyaki soup base as it is sweet. The range of meat isn't very wide but the meat are fresh. My favourite would be the marble pork. You can also choose either rice or udon to go with your meal.

There are also many other things in the soup such as vegetables, mushrooms, bean curd and noodles. However, the ventilation in the restaurant is not very good, so prepare to smell like steamboat after eating.

Tom Yum Hor Fun OK Aug 11, 2012   
Share on TwitterShare on Facebook
Categories : Thai

Tried their Tom Yum Hor Fun for the first time. It's more spicy than I have initially expected. Do not be deceive by the innocent looks of the tom yum hor fun, as it is actually quite spicy. The hor fun was over-fried, leaving a burnt aftertaste which is quite unpleasant. The prawn wasn't fresh too. I only ended up having one prawn. Overall, it's quite a unique twist to the ordinary hor fun but I would not try this dish again.

FIsh Head Curry Smile Aug 11, 2012   
Share on TwitterShare on Facebook
Categories : Coffeeshop | Brunch

Tried their fish head curry. Their curry is more of assam style. It's a bit sour and spicy at the same time. When you try this dish, you should have it with rice or bread (if you're opting for a lighter choice). The fish head curry here is also much cheaper than many other places that I've tried before. The fish head curry cost $25 and an extra $1 if you're taking it out. And the fish head is both sides, which means plenty of meat for 4 people to share.

Baby Crayfish Pasta Smile Aug 08, 2012   
Share on TwitterShare on Facebook
Categories : Multi-Cuisine | Restaurant

 

 

 

 

 
I went there during Sunday, but it's quite quiet. The ambience is really relaxing and there's not much traffic. The perfect place to relax on a Sunday. Ordered the marble cheese coffee, which was really unique. It first tasted like normal coffee, then the after-taste of the cheese will take over the coffee taste. The baby crayfish pasta is one of my favourite pasta now. They are really generous with the baby crayfish and the wasabi roe. However, they may have sprinkled too much wasabi roe as the taste of the wasabi dominates the whole dish. If you don't like wasabi, do remind the staff to remove the roe for you.

The seafood aglio olio is average. Another dish that I like from here is the marble cheesecake. The base of the cheesecake is chocolate. With the cheese, it leaves a long lasting taste. Even though the price is a bit steep, it's a great place to relax on a Sunday afternoon

Ginseng chicken soup Smile Aug 08, 2012   
Share on TwitterShare on Facebook
Categories : Korean | Restaurant

 

 

 

 

 
The ginseng chicken soup is a must-try for this restaurant. The broth is tasty. Even though there's glutinous rice in the soup, they matched it with a bowl of brown rice. This makes it perfect for sharing. It also comes with 4 side dishes. The kimchi is slightly salty but it's ok when you eat it together with the rice.

Another highlight is the kimchi fried rice. The kimchi taste is just nice. This dish is also quite large and can be shared between 2 people. If you're looking for something that is spicy, you should try the dobokki. (Spicy rice cake).
